The Automated Labor Landscape

Automated labor refers to the process of replacing manually completed actions with technology. While it has colloquially often referred to using machinery to replace physical labor, it is increasingly used to refer to the automation of less physically-intensive tasks across sectors like marketing, customer support, and data analytics.
